Descripción : The Bellavista neighborhood of the Quevedo canton is located on the slope near the Quevedo river, at the moment the sector is in a state of emergency as a result of the winter wave, which caused the increase in rainfall, which generated part of the slope and the vegetation cover fell off, endangering the lives of the population and the settled dwellings of the sector. The risk for landslide has been identified but not evaluated in its entirety, on the other hand, the Risk Management Secretariat of the canton does not have a standard methodology to evaluate and minimize the potential effects in the case of the materialization of natural risk. This research project aims to apply the methodology established by the United Nations Development Program (PNUD) for the evaluation of landslide risk, applied in Peru, and seeks to determine the level of risk in the Bellavista neighborhood and propose measures to increase the capacity of the neighborhood to respond to the threat. Three main factors will be analyzed: social, environmental and economic through the characterization of the study area. For this analysis, two methodologies will be followed: inductive and deductive. The analysis will be supported by the gathering of information in the field through surveys, photographs, interviews and the development of the Check-list and a FODA analysis, the parties surveyed will be the public organizations and the inhabitants of the Bellavista neighborhood. Subsequently, with the information raised, the natural risk assessment will be carried out using matrices through the study of the threat and vulnerability presented by the neighborhood, and then the risk level will be established by color scales due to the combination of the threat and the vulnerabilities. Finally, the ArcGIS software will design risk maps of the risk areas. Once the level of natural risk has been identified and evaluated, Auto protection and Emergency Plan will be proposed, developing measures and technical actions to increase the response capacity of the neighborhood, the plan will contain recommendations for preventive activities, and will seek to strengthen management organizations of risks on natural events.
